Handover: Stockbot restock planner

Taking two weeks off. Stockbot plans vending-machine restocks nightly at 02:00. If routes look wrong, check the demand-decay settings first — that's the usual culprit. Don't touch the depot priority list without flagging ops. Redeploys are safe; state lives in the planner DB. Current production settings for reference are below.

settings of fafog-haduf:
ZORIX_PIN=4648
ZORIX_METRICS_HOST=metrics.zorix.paliqsys.corp
ZORIX_LOG_LEVEL=info
ZORIX_TENANT=druix

# Weekly Cash-Box Run

Every Friday morning, the petty-cash box from the Millbrent office heads over to the central counting room at Harrowgate House. It's a small grey strongbox, sealed with a numbered tag, and it always travels with the regular courier on the 10:15 loop. Dispatch logs the tag number before it leaves and the counting room confirms on arrival. Nothing fancy, just keep it consistent. When the courier shows up, relay this instruction verbatim:

courier memo of bawig-kahap: the casath ralmir courier leaves the norok weniel norok druvan frador ulaiel belix druael ledger at gate 3981 under passcode 761393

☐ Locate the first-aid room. It's on Level 2 of the Quenborough building, next to the print hub, marked with a green cross. Familiarise yourself with it on day one — you may need to direct others there. A trained first aider is listed on the noticeboard outside; check the rota each week. The room stays locked outside office hours for stock security. To open it when needed, enter the code provided below.

door code, kawip-bagap: bdg-HQEWH-4